What you'll handle

·Run short, friendly parent-teacher conversations regularly.
·Maintain classroom safety and child-friendly hygiene practices.
·Prepare students for school transition (KG to Grade 1 readiness).
·Lead circle time, songs, stories and structured activity stations.
·Plan and run a play-based daily timetable for 3–5 year olds.

Working in a CBSE school

This school follows the CBSE framework, so expect continuous and comprehensive assessment, NEP-aligned competency questions, and a strong emphasis on subject enrichment activities.
